Frequently Asked Questions about Holly Hills
How much are Studio apartments in Holly Hills?
There are currently 129 Studio Apartments in Holly Hills with rent ranges from $650 to $750 with an average price of $680.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Holly Hills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Holly Hills ranges from $650 to $2,745 with an average monthly rent of $935.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Holly Hills c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Holly Hills range from $800 to $4,941.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,231.
How expensive are Holly Hills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 27 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Holly Hills on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,295 to $4,460 - averaging $1,896 for the location.
